Manufacturer: SAMSUNG

Part Number: KA2657

Specifications:

  • Type: Integrated Circuit (IC)
  • Category: Voltage Regulator
  • Output Voltage: Adjustable/Fixed (specific value depends on variant)
  • Output Current: Up to 1A (typical)
  • Input Voltage Range: 4.5V to 40V
  • Package Type: TO-220 or similar (exact package may vary)
  • Operating Temperature Range: -25°C to +125°C
  • Features:
  • Overcurrent protection
  • Thermal shutdown
  • Short-circuit protection

Descriptions:

The KA2657 is a voltage regulator IC designed for stable power supply applications. It provides a regulated output voltage from an unregulated input, suitable for various electronic devices.

## Design Phase Pitfall Avoidance

To maximize the effectiveness of the KA2657 in these applications, engineers should be mindful of common design challenges:

1. Thermal Management

While the KA2657 is designed for efficiency, improper thermal dissipation can lead to overheating and reduced lifespan. Ensure adequate PCB layout spacing, heat sinks, or thermal vias where necessary, especially in high-current applications.

2. Input Voltage Stability

Fluctuations in input voltage can affect performance. Incorporate proper filtering capacitors and transient voltage suppressors (TVS) to mitigate voltage spikes and ensure stable operation.

3. Electromagnetic Interference (EMI)

In high-frequency applications, EMI can degrade signal quality. Shielding techniques, proper grounding, and careful trace routing should be implemented to minimize interference.

4. Component Compatibility

Mismatched passive components (e.g., capacitors, inductors) can lead to instability. Always refer to the datasheet for recommended values and verify compatibility through simulation or prototyping.

5. Load Variations

Sudden load changes may cause voltage drops or overshoots. Implementing feedback loops or soft-start circuits can help maintain stability under dynamic load conditions.

By carefully considering these factors during the design phase, engineers can leverage the KA2657’s full potential while avoiding common pitfalls that compromise performance and reliability. Proper planning, simulation, and testing are essential to achieving optimal results in any application.
